Tim became Club Professional in 1994 to be there for the opening of the new ten holes making Newton Green into a testing 18 hole golf course.
Tim started golf at the age of 14 and joined the Junior section at Stoke By Nayland Golf Club and by the age of 17 achieved a handicap of 3.
Tim was a Qualified PGA Professional at the age of 20 after passing his PGA exams and continued working as Head Assistant with Kevin Lovelock at Stoke By Nayland. During his time at Stoke Tim helped out at Newton Green Golf Club a couple of days a week and then joined the club full time in 1994. Then in 1997 took over the golf shop business and became the full Club Professional at Newton Green Golf Club.
